Brian Kish is Senior Vice President for Central Development at the University of Arizona Foundation. His responsibilities include oversight of the UA Foundation offices of Annual Giving, Prospect Management and Research, Communications and Marketing, Donor Services, Gift Planning, and the GIFT Center.

The Central Development team is a division of the UA Foundation that provides University faculty, staff and development personnel support with their non-governmental charitable grantseeking activities.

Kish has more than 14 years of experience in development. Prior to joining the UA Foundation, he spent nearly five years in Newport, Rhode Island, serving as the Assistant Vice President for Advancement at Salve Regina University. His responsibilities included the management and operation of development and alumni/parent relations activities.

Since 2001, Kish also served as an Independent Fundraising Consultant focused on annual giving consultation and alumni relations. The company, which Kish co-established, was associated with Campbell & Company, Chicago.

From 2002-2005, Kish was Senior Director of Development and Assistant Campaign Manager at the University of California, Irvine. Before that, he spent eight years at the Iowa State University Foundation where he worked his way up from Assistant Director of Annual Giving Programs to Director of Annual Giving Programs.

Kish holds a bachelor’s degree in political science with a focus in international relations from Ohio University. He is currently working toward attaining his master’s in management with a focus in holistic leadership.

In addition to his extensive development background, Kish has won numerous regional and national awards for program excellence, including the Crystal Apple Teaching Award from the Council for the Advancement and Support of Education (CASE). He is the youngest recipient of this prestigious honor for outstanding CASE presenters.
